1. Product Overview

Palladium Recovery Concentrate is a high-grade intermediate material derived from secondary sources, engineered for efficient recovery of platinum group metals. Its primary industrial use is as a feedstock in precious metal refining operations to extract palladium for catalytic, electronic, and chemical applications. The key value proposition lies in its elevated palladium content and low impurity profile, which significantly reduces smelting time, reagent consumption, and overall refining costs. It is strategically important in the market as global demand for palladium outpaces primary mining supply, making secure, traceable secondary sources critical for manufacturers and refiners seeking supply chain resilience.

2. Key Specifications & Technical Characteristics

  • Chemical Composition: Palladium content 8.0% – 22.0% dry basis; Platinum <1.5%; Rhodium <0.8%; Gold <0.5%; Base metals (Cu, Ni, Fe) <12.0% combined; Silica/Alumina matrix balance
  • Purity Level / Grade: Industrial refining grade; Classified as PGM-rich secondary concentrate; Loss on Ignition (LOI) <15% at 950°C
  • Physical Characteristics:
    • Form: Free-flowing granular powder
    • Color: Dark grey to black
    • Particle Size: 80% passing 75 microns (200 mesh)
    • Bulk Density: 1.8 – 2.4 g/cm³
    • Moisture: <3.0% as shipped
  • Packaging Options: 1MT FIBC jumbo bags with inner PE liner on heat-treated pallets; 25kg steel drums with tamper-evident seal; Bulk vessel shipment available
  • Shelf Life: Chemically stable under dry storage; 24 months when stored in sealed packaging below 30°C and 60% RH
